Davis Rescues Draw For The Seagulls
A goal from Conor Davis in the 80th minute earned Bray Wanderers a draw against a dogged Longford Town side.
Town had taken the lead in the 10th minute through Josh Giurgi and dominated the second half but couldn’t add to that goal.
Aodh Dervin had a goal ruled out for offside in the 64th minute while Giurgi hit the crossbar in stoppage time.
The first chance of the game yielded a goal in the 10th minute. Gary Armstong played the ball out wide to Shane Elworthy, he in turn found Giurgi with a fine pass and the striker made no mistake with an excellent finish.
After that neither keeper had to do much as no chances were created. Bray enjoyed possession but couldn’t muster up anything to test Town keeper Jack Brady.
In the 29th minute former Town player Joe Power hit a free that went over the bar. Minutes later a corner from Power found the head of Ger Shortt but he directed his effort over from close range.
Down the other end substitute Viktor Serdeniuk’s effort got a touch out for a corner in the 35th minute. Ben Feeney brought a save out of Brady one minute later. Brady made a good save to deny Jake Walker in the 43rd minute.
Power’s corner in the 46th minute was headed straight at Brady by Cole Omorehiomwan. The home side took a hold of the game after that. Dervin picked up a pass by Giurgi and hit a fantastic strike to the net but it was flagged for offside; it was tight.
Former Bray player Darragh Lynch weaved his way into the box on 67th minute and Dane Massey had to be alert to clear the danger out for a corner.
Town were made to rue missed opportunities when Bray drew level in the 80th minute; a cross from the left found former Town player Davis and he fired an excellent strike to the net.
In the 90th minute Massey hit a free just over the bar. In stoppage time Town could’ve nicked the three points; Giurgi hit the crossbar from Adam Verdon’s free and Mohamed Boudiaf fired over from close range.
